The Spark: Georgia's Voting Laws

Okay, let's start with the central issue: the state of Georgia. The controversy began with the passage of a new voting law in Georgia. This law, which introduced new restrictions on voting access, immediately drew sharp criticism from voting rights advocates, civil rights organizations, and many prominent figures in the United States. Many people felt the new voting law was designed to suppress the vote, particularly among minority groups. The MLB, like many other major corporations, found itself in a difficult position. The league had to decide whether to continue business as usual or take a stand. This law was widely criticized for its potential to disproportionately affect minority voters. This voting law was seen by many as an attempt to restrict voting access, especially for minority communities. The law's provisions, including limitations on early voting and stricter voter ID requirements, were scrutinized. MLB's Response and the Decision to Move the Game

Faced with the pressure, the MLB took decisive action. The league announced its decision to relocate the 2021 All-Star Game and the draft from Atlanta, Georgia. This was a bold move, signaling the MLB's strong opposition to the new voting law. The MLB’s decision to move the All-Star Game from Atlanta was a watershed moment. The announcement sent shockwaves throughout the sports world and beyond. The relocation of the All-Star Game from Atlanta was a clear message that the MLB would not support a state that passed a law seen as discriminatory. This decision was a powerful statement of support for voting rights. The league’s statement clearly stated the reasons behind the move. It made clear the league's stance against restrictive voting laws. The relocation was also coupled with a commitment to support voting rights through various initiatives. The New Host: Denver, Colorado

So, where did the All-Star Game end up? The MLB chose Denver, Colorado, as the new host city. Denver was selected due to the city's commitment to voting rights and its relatively liberal political climate. Denver offered a stark contrast to Georgia, aligning with the MLB's stance on voting access.
